    I have an old 2310 furnace -downflow and wish to move it to my basement and convert it to flow UP. Is this possible?

    The plate on the heater should tell you if it can be installed up, down or horizontal. It is not that easy since fan has to be reversed, AC coil relocated and probably burners too. Craigslist has heaters for sale and updraft is most common. In fact, some HVAC installers will give older ones away to get rid of them.
